Lara-Escandell M, Gamberini C, Juliana NC, Al-Nasiry S, Morré SA, Ambrosino E. The association between non-viral sexually transmitted infections and pregnancy outcome in Latin America and the Caribbean: A systematic review. Heliyon 2024; 10:e23338. Abstract
Introduction Non-viral sexually transmitted infections are known to be associated with adverse pregnancy outcomes. For these pathogens, standard antenatal screening is not broadly performed in Latin America and the Caribbean. The aim of this study was to comprehensively review the association of non-viral sexually transmitted infections and neonatal outcomes among pregnant women in the region. Methods Four databases (PubMed, Embase, SciELO and LILACS) were examined to identify eligible studies published up to September 2022. English or Spanish cross-sectional, case-control and cohort studies assessing the association of non-viral sexually transmitted infections and adverse pregnancy outcomes were evaluated. Articles were firstly screened by means of title and abstract. Potential articles were fully read and assessed for inclusion according to the eligibility criteria. Snowballing search was performed by screening of bibliographies of the chosen potentially relevant papers. Risk of bias within studies was assessed using the Joanna Briggs Institute reviewer's manual. Results A selection of 10 out of 9772 search records from five Latin America and the Caribbean countries were included. Six studies associated Treponema pallidum infection with preterm birth (1/6), history of previous spontaneous abortion (2/6), fetal and infant death (1/6), low birth weight (1/6) and funisitis of the umbilical cord (1/6). Three studies associated Chlamydia trachomatis infection with preterm birth (2/3), ectopic pregnancy (1/3) and respiratory symptoms on the newborn (1/3). One study associated Mycoplasma genitalium infection with preterm birth. Conclusion This review provides evidence on the association of non-viral sexually transmitted infections with adverse pregnancy outcomes. Further investigation is needed to establish more associations between non-viral sexually transmitted infections and pregnancy outcome, especially for Mycoplasma genitalium, Trichomonas vaginalis and Neisseria gonorrhoeae. Overall, this review calls for more research for public health interventions to promote screening of non-viral sexually transmitted infections during pregnancy, among high-risk population groups of pregnant women living in the region.

Yokoi K, Minamiguchi S, Honda Y, Kobayashi M, Kobayashi S, Nishikomori R. Necrotizing Funisitis as an Intrauterine manifestation of Cryopyrin-Associated Periodic Syndrome: a case report and review of the literature. Pediatr Rheumatol Online J 2021; 19:77. Abstract
BACKGROUND Cryopyrin-associated periodic syndrome (CAPS) is a life-long, autoinflammatory disease associated with a gain-of-function mutation in the nucleotide-binding domain, leucine-rich repeat family, pyrin domain containing 3 (NLRP3) gene, which result in uncontrolled production of IL-1β and chronic inflammation. Chronic infantile neurologic cutaneous and articular (CINCA) syndrome/neonatal-Onset multisystem inflammatory disease (NOMID) is the most severe form of CAPS. Although the first symptoms may be presented at birth, there are few reports on the involvement of the placenta and umbilical cord in the disease. Therefore, we present herein a preterm case of CINCA/NOMID syndrome and confirms intrauterine-onset inflammation with conclusive evidence by using fetal and placental histopathological examination. CASE PRESENTATION The female patient was born at 33weeks of gestation by emergency caesarean section and weighted at 1,514 g. The most common manifestations of CINCA/NOMID syndrome including recurrent fever, urticarial rash, and ventriculomegaly due to aseptic meningitis were presented. She also exhibited atypical symptoms such as severe hepatosplenomegaly with cholestasis. The genetic analysis of NLRP3 revealed a heterozygous c.1698 C > G (p.Phe566Leu) mutation, and she was diagnosed with CINCA/NOMID syndrome. Further, a histopathological examination revealed necrotizing funisitis, mainly inflammation of the umbilical artery, along with focal neutrophilic and lymphocytic villitis. CONCLUSIONS The necrotizing funisitis, which only involved the artery, was an unusual observation for chorioamnionitis. These evidences suggest that foetal inflammation, probably due to overproduction of IL-1β, caused tissue damage in utero, and the first symptom of a newborn with CINCA/NOMID.

Wang W, Zhang M, Gong L, Wu Q. Necrotizing funisitis and calcification of umbilical vein: case report and review. BMC Pregnancy Childbirth 2021; 21:296. Abstract
BACKGROUND Necrotising funisitis (NF) is a rare, chronic stage of funisitis, a severe inflammation of the umbilical cord and an important risk factor for fetal adverse outcomes. NF is characterized by yellow-white bands running parallel to the umbilical blood vessels. These bands consist of inflammatory cells, necrotic debris, and calcium deposits. Calcification is visible in ultrasonography, which makes it possible to suspect NF when umbilical vascular wall calcification is detected by prenatal ultrasonography. CASE PRESENTATION Ultrasonography revealed calcification of the umbilical venous wall in an expectant 31-year-old woman who was gravida 1, para 0. The woman required emergency cesarean section because of fetal distress and suspected umbilical cord torsion at 31 weeks gestation. The root of the umbilical cord was quite fragile and broke during the operation. The pathological results on the placenta showed histologic chorioamnionitis and NF. The infant was diagnosed to have neonatal sepsis and acidosis after delivery but was discharged without severe complications after a one-month hospitalization that included antibiotic and supportive therapy. CONCLUSION NF is a rare and severe inflammation of the umbilical cord. Umbilical vascular wall calcification discovered in prenatal ultrasonography is diagnostically helpful.

Abstract
Miscarriage is a frequent complication of human pregnancy: ∼50% to 70% of spontaneous conceptions are lost prior to the second trimester. Etiology of miscarriage includes genetic abnormalities, infections, immunological and implantation disorders, uterine and endocrine abnormalities, and lifestyle factors. Given such variability, knowledge regarding causes, pathophysiological mechanisms, and morphologies of primary early pregnancy loss has significant gaps; often, pregnancy losses remain unexplained. Pathologic evaluation of miscarriage tissue is an untapped source of knowledge. Although miscarriage specimens comprise a significant part of pathologists' workload, information reported from these specimens is typically of minimal clinical utility for delineating etiology or predicting recurrence risk. Standardized terminology is available, though not universally used. We reintroduce the terminology and review new information about early pregnancy losses and their morphologies. Current clinical terminology is inconsistent, hampering research progress. This review is a resource for diagnostic pathologists studying this complex problem.

Sebastian M, Giles R, Roberts J, Poonacha K, Harrison L, Donahue J, Benirschke K. Funisitis Associated with Leptospiral Abortion in an Equine Placenta. Vet Pathol 2016; 42:659-62. Abstract
Funisitis, inflammation of the umbilical cord, is well recognized in human placentas. This report describes a case of funisitis associated with leptospiral infection in the placenta of a Thoroughbred foal born prematurely. The umbilical cord had diffuse superficial yellow discoloration along its entire length. Microscopic evaluation showed an exudate of neutrophils admixed with fibrin on the surface. Warthin-Starry staining showed spirochetes in the Wharton's jelly of the umbilical cord. A locally extensive, severe placentitis not involving the star and allantoic cystic hyperplasia were the other lesions observed in the allantochorion. Leptospira funisitis is similar to the funisitis of congenital syphilis in humans, although there are some major microscopic differences. in Leptospira funisitis, lesions were limited to the cord surface, whereas in lesions in human umbilical cords with Treponema pallidum infection, the changes are observed mostly around the vessels and in the Wharton's jelly.

Akahira-Azuma M, Kubota M, Hosokawa S, Kaneshige M, Yasuda N, Sato N, Matsushita T. Republication: Two Premature Neonates of Congenital Syphilis with Severe Clinical Manifestations. Trop Med Health 2015; 43:165-70. Abstract
Congenital syphilis (CS) is a public health burden in both developing and developed countries. We report two cases of CS in premature neonates with severe clinical manifestations; Patient 1 (gestational age 31 weeks, birth weight 1423 g) had disseminated idiopathic coagulation (DIC) while Patient 2 (gestational age 34 weeks and 6 days, birth weight 2299 g) had refractory syphilitic meningitis. Their mothers were single and had neither received antenatal care nor undergone syphilis screening. Both neonates were delivered via an emergency cesarean section and had birth asphyxia and transient tachypnea of newborn. Physical examination revealed massive hepatosplenomegaly. Laboratory testing of maternal and neonatal blood showed increased rapid plasma reagin (RPR) titer and positive Treponema pallidum hemagglutination assay. Diagnosis of CS was further supported by a positive IgM fluorescent treponemal antibody absorption test and large amounts of T. pallidum spirochetes detected in the placenta. Each neonate was initially treated with ampicillin and cefotaxime for early bacterial sepsis/meningitis that coexisted with CS. Patient 1 received fresh frozen plasma and antithrombin III to treat DIC. Patient 2 experienced a relapse of CS during initial antibiotic treatment, necessitating parenteral penicillin G. Treatment was effective in both neonates, as shown by reductions in RPR. Monitoring of growth and neurological development through to age 4 showed no evidence of apparent delay or complications. Without adequate antenatal care and maternal screening tests for infection, CS is difficult for non-specialists to diagnose at birth, because the clinical manifestations are similar to those of neonatal sepsis and meningitis. Ampicillin was insufficient for treating CS and penicillin G was necessary.

Schuetz AN, Guarner J, Packard MM, Zaki SR, Shehata BM, Opreas-Ilies G. Infectious disease immunohistochemistry in placentas from HIV-positive and HIV-negative patients. Pediatr Dev Pathol 2011; 14:180-8. Abstract
Studies comparing placental pathology between human immunodeficiency virus (HIV)-positive and HIV-negative patients have shown conflicting results. In addition, few studies have evaluated the infectious etiology of placental inflammation in HIV-positive patients. We examined a cohort of placentas from 73 HIV-positive and 41 HIV-negative patients to gain a better understanding of the spectrum of placental inflammatory lesions. Bacterial and viral immunohistochemistry (IHC) was run on a subset of placentas (12 HIV-positive and 7 HIV-negative) with the greatest amount of inflammation. Although few histologic differences were seen between the HIV-positive and HIV-negative groups, chorioamnionitis was of a higher stage in the HIV-positive placentas. An infectious agent was found by IHC in 3 of 7 HIV-negative patients (2 Neisseria spp. and 1 group B Streptococcus ). One HIV-positive placenta showed gram-positive cocci on fetal membranes; organisms were not detected by IHC. In 2 patients, the etiologic agent was not suspected prior to IHC. This study identified that acute inflammation is less common in placentas from HIV-positive patients, compared with HIV-negative patients. However, when severe inflammation is present, infectious organisms may be identified by IHC, providing a more specific diagnosis and offering a beneficial impact in maternal and fetal management.

Kakogawa J, Sadatsuki M, Masuya N, Gomibuchi H, Minoura S, Hoshimoto K. Prolonged fetal bradycardia as the presenting clinical sign in congenital syphilis complicated by necrotizing funisitis: a case report. ISRN Obstet Gynecol 2011; 2011:320246. Abstract
Syphilis remains a serious cause of neonatal morbidity and mortality worldwide. In this paper, we describe a case of congenital syphilis that was fully supported by abnormal fetal heart rate patterns and placental histopathological evidence. A 24-year-old para 4 woman, who did not attend antenatal care, was admitted to our hospital with a complaint of abdominal discomfort at an estimated 31-week gestation. Fetal heart rate monitoring showed prolonged bradycardia. A neonate weighting 1,423 g with severe birth asphyxia was immediately delivered by cesarean section. Following delivery, the mother and the neonate were diagnosed with syphilis. Histopathological examination confirmed severe chorioamnionitis and necrotizing funisitis with numerous Treponema pallidum. Conclusions. Challenges in establishing the diagnosis of necrotizing funisitis are essential for optimal management of a fetus with a systemic inflammatory response in utero.

Abstract
A wide spectrum of adrenal gland pathology is seen during bacterial infections. Hemorrhage is particularly associated with meningococcemia, while abscesses have been described with several neonatal infections. We studied adrenal gland histopathology of 65 patients with bacterial infections documented in a variety of tissues by using immunohistochemistry. The infections diagnosed included Neisseria meningitidies, group A streptococcus, Rickettsia rickettsii, Streptococcus pneumoniae, Staphylococcus aureus, Ehrlichia sp., Bacillus anthracis, Leptospira sp., Clostridium sp., Klebsiella sp., Legionella sp., Yersinia pestis, and Treponema pallidum. Bacteria were detected in the adrenal of 40 (61%) cases. Adrenal hemorrhage was present in 39 (60%) cases. Bacteria or bacterial antigens were observed in 31 (79%) of the cases with adrenal hemorrhage including 14 with N. meningitidis, four with R. rickettsii, four with S. pneumoniae, three with group A streptococcus, two with S. aureus, two with B. anthracis, one with T. pallidum, and one with Legionella sp. Bacterial antigens were observed in nine of 26 non-hemorrhagic adrenal glands that showed inflammatory foci (four cases), edema (two cases), congestion (two cases), or necrosis (one case). Hemorrhage is the most frequent adrenal gland pathology observed in fatal bacterial infections. Bacteria and bacterial antigens are frequently seen in adrenal glands with hemorrhage and may play a pathogenic role. Although N. meningitidis is the most frequent bacteria associated with adrenal gland pathology, a broad collection of bacteria can also cause adrenal lesions.

Zitterkopf NL, Haven TR, Huela M, Bradley DS, Cafruny WA. Transplacental lactate dehydrogenase-elevating virus (LDV) transmission: immune inhibition of umbilical cord infection, and correlation of fetal virus susceptibility with development of F4/80 antigen expression. Abstract
Maternal-to-fetal transmission of the murine lactate dehydrogenase-elevating virus (LDV) has been previously shown to be regulated by maternal immunity as well as gestational age. For the present study, the role of maternal immunity in placental and umbilical cord virus protection was studied, and virus targeting of umbilical cord and fetal macrophages was correlated with expression of the F4/80 macrophage phenotypic marker. The results showed that LDV-infected macrophages appeared in umbilical cord by 24 h post-infection of pregnant mice, and some LDV-infected macrophages displayed the F4/80 phenotype. This potential reservoir of virus for the fetus was inhibited by passive immunization of pregnant mice with IgG anti-LDV antibodies, which rapidly concentrated in the placenta and umbilical cord. Probing of umbilical cord cells with antibodies directed at MHC genetic markers demonstrated the presence of both maternal and fetal cells in umbilical cords. A strong developmental correlation was observed between fetal F4/80 expression and LDV susceptibility, at about 13.6 days of gestation. These results demonstrate immune suppression of free and cell-associated virus in umbilical cord, thus defining a potentially important mechanism for immune protection of the fetus from transplacental virus infection. The results also clarify the developmental basis for fetal susceptibility to LDV infection.
